The sanding units as modular elements
|
|
-
Precise steel roller with vibration-free run for heavy calibration works
-
Surface of the steel roller with spiral embeddings in order to guarantee aggressive attack and good cooling
-
The stock removal depends on the grit of the sanding belt, the feed speed, the power of the drive motor and the quantity of the roller units
-
Heesemann achieves a perfect surface after the calibration by means of contact rollers by one or several following fine sanding units
-
For certain applications rubber rollers in all different shores and different diameters are also available

-
the sanding belt runs cross against feed direction - so the wood fibres are cut off optimally and cannot raise up again after the lacquering process.
-
Pressure of the sanding belt onto the workpiece is effected by means of a segmented pressure beam with CSD®-System
-
Due to the following cross sanding unit behind a roller unit an important grit graduation is possible

Longitudinal sanding unit
|
|
-
Longitudinal belt executes a final sanding in grain direction
-
Elastic belt tensioning guarantees a high adaptability of the sanding belt
-
Pressure of the sanding belt onto the workpiece is effected by means of a segmented pressure beam with CSD®-System

Longitudinal sanding unit with CSD Plus double pressure beam
|
|
-
The CSD® Plus double pressure beam ensures a finer sanding surface
-
The CSD® Plus system works with two independents controllable CSD® pressure beams
-
By that it is in fact not possible to replace two successive units with graded sanding belt grits, but for different applications a finer surface is produced.
-
Also the combination of pressure segment belt and CSD Plus double pressure beam for the last longitudinal sanding unit is possible and once again leads to a finer surface

Especially on frame parts with different grain direction the longitudinal traces of the cross veneered upper and lower parts of the frames have to be minimized. This is done by two orbital sanding units which make the total impression of the frame surface more harmonious. |
